Abstract

System and method for treating a skin target. A temperature effector creates a temperature difference between the target and the skin tissue surrounding the target such that the target is at a higher temperature than the surrounding the. One or more RP electrodes are attached to the skin and RE energy is applied.

Claims

exact text as granted — not AI-modified
1 . A system for treating a skin target comprising: 
 (a) one or more RF electrodes configured to be attached to the skin, so as to apply an RF current to the skin;    (b) a temperature effector configured to create a temperature difference between the target and skin surrounding the target such that the target is at a higher temperature than the surrounding tissue.    
     
     
         2 . The system according to  claim 1  wherein the temperature effector heats the target.  
     
     
         3 . The system according to  claim 2  wherein the temperature effector comprises a light source configured to apply optical energy to the target.  
     
     
         4 . The system according to  claim 1  wherein the temperature effector cools the surrounding tissue.  
     
     
         5 . The system according to  claim 4  wherein the temperature effector comprises an irrigation unit cooling a fluid and tubes for allowing the cooled fluid to flow near the surrounding skin.  
     
     
         6 . A method for treating a skin target comprising: 
 (a) creating a temperature gradient between the target and skin surrounding the target such that the target is at a higher temperature than the surrounding skin; and    (b) applying RF energy to the skin.    
     
     
         7 . The method according to  claim 6  wherein the temperature gradient is created by heating the target.  
     
     
         8 . The method according to  claim 7  wherein the target is heated by applying optical energy to the target.  
     
     
         9 . The method according to  claim 5  wherein the temperature gradient is created by cooling the skin surrounding the target.  
     
     
         10 . The met-hod according to  claim 9  wherein the surrounding skin is cooled by contacting the skin with a pre-cooled fluid.  
     
     
         11 . The method according to  claim 6  wherein the target is selected from the group comprising a vascular lesion, pigmented lesion, hair follicle, wrinkle and acne.
